    Abstract: The disclosure concerns a hydroelectric machine including a tube-type hydraulic machine having a bladed wheel which rotates about a horizontal axis and is provided with fixed blades which are encircled by, and connected with, a rim to which the rotor of a surrounding electrical machine is attached. The wheel, rim and rotor form a single rotating unit which is supported in the radial direction without physical contact by at least two hydrostatic centering supporting devices and at least one hydrostatic damping device. At least one hydrostatic load-beaing device may be included for accepting without physical contact a constant portion of the weight of the rotating unit. In addition, the machine may include hydrostatic supporting devices, of the centering type or of both the centering and the damping type, for accepting without physical contact the axial thrusts imposed on the rotating unit.

    Abstract: A supporting device for a mobile part which is subjected to dynamic forces relieves the normal support bearings of the necessity of handling these unusual loads. The device comprises a support element which adjoins the mobile part, and a hydraulic control which causes that element to supply a constant, relatively small supporting reaction under normal conditions, which may produce slow displacements of the mobile part, and to supply an increased or decreased reaction, depending upon the direction of movement, when the mobile part is displaced rapidly by the dynamic forces.

    Abstract: A rolling device or roller mill having a controlled-deflection roll possessing a stationary roll support or carrier mounted in a frame of the rolling mill. A tubular roll shell is rotatable about the roll support and bears thereon by means of at least one bearing or support element. The roll shell is provided at its ends with guide members which are rotatably mounted in the roll shell and which are guided on the roll support in the direction of the pressing or disengaging movement of the roll shell. The controlled-deflection roll is equipped with a scraper device having a scraper blade which, during operation, is in contact with the outer surface of the roll shell, the scraper device being rotatably mounted on the frame. At least one of the guide members has a disengaging or lift-off element which, when the roll shell performs a disengaging or lift-off movement from the operative position, abuts a part of the blade support or carrier and raises the blade off the surface of the roll shell.

    Abstract: Hydrostatic supporting apparatus which supports, without physical contact, a mobile part which moves relatively to a load-bearing part. The apparatus comprises a supporting piston which has at least one hydrostatic bearing pocket which provides a pressure cushion through which the mobile part is supported, and which is urged toward the mobile part by a controlled pressure which increases and decreases, respectively, as the piston moves toward and away from the load-bearing part. Preferably, pressure control is effected by a throttle valve interposed either in a supply path leading from a source of pressure medium to the pressure chamber of a hydraulic supporting motor, or in a feed passage leading from that pressure chamber to the bearing pocket.

    Abstract: An apparatus is disclosed comprising a strand guide formed by guide plates which are supported and cooled by hydrostatic support elements. The support elements each include a cylinder and a piston which is stressed against the guide plate by pressure fluid supplied to the cylinder. The pistons are each provided with a bearing pad having a plurality of recesses each supplied with fluid at a constant rate which forms hydrostatic support for and cools the guide plates. The forces exerted by the support elements may be controlled by pressure regulating valves in the fluid supply lines leading thereto in response to sensors which sense positional shifts of the guide plates from a set point. The apparatus may also include a controller for the valves which periodically reduces the pressure of the fluid supplied to the support elements sufficiently to allow the casting to move along the strand guide.

    Abstract: A method of, and apparatus for, adjusting the contact pressure of a rolling mill for rolling a web of material, the rolling mill comprising at least one controlled deflection roll equipped with a plurality of hydrostatic pressure elements operable by means of a hydraulic pressure medium. After the web of material has passed through the rolling mill the action of such rolling mill upon the web of material is measured at a number of points or locations across the web and the pressure of the pressure medium supplied to the individual pressure elements associated with the measuring points or locations is adjusted as a function of the measured values such that there is obtained a desired reference value for the action of the rolling mill at the measuring points or locations.

    Abstract: Hydrostatic apparatus for supporting a mobile part which moves relatively to a foundation comprises a bearing shoe having a bearing face containing a pressure pocket, and a hydraulic servomotor which exerts on the shoe a force urging it toward the mobile part. A support element connected with the shoe and the foundation positively holds the shoe against movement in at least one direction along its supporting axis, and its restraint is so correlated with the pressure forces acting on the shoe that the latter is rendered non-displaceable. Depending upon the relative magnitudes of the forces developed by the servomotor and by the pressure acting on the bearing face, the support element may normally be unloaded, loaded in tension or loaded in compression. In the first case, the support element prevents movement of the shoe in opposite directions along the support axis, whereas in the second and third cases it may permit movement of the shoe toward and away from the foundation, respectively.

    Abstract: A deflection-controlled roll has a roll shell rotatably mounted about a fixed beam and disposed on a plurality of hydraulic piston support or pressure devices positioned along the roll for exerting forces between the beam and the roll shell. The roll shell is formed of an elastomeric material and is provided with a stiffener insert embedded in the material of the shell for increasing its resistance to circumferential deformation. The stiffener insert may include a metal helical coil extending about the axis of the roll shell or a corrugated tube coaxial with the shell. The roll shell may also include a plurality of annular inserts spaced along the interior of the shell the inner surfaces of which form bearing surfaces for the support devices.
